现在,技术规范、分类标准、实例文档和样式表这四方面共同组成了如今的我们所看到的XBRL技术。
(一)XBRL的技术规范
现在的XBRL都是以XBRL技术规范为基础来发展完善的,从1989年XBRL技术诞生算起,现在的技术规范一共更新了三种规划书本:1.0版本、2.0版本、2.1版本。当下,XBRL的2.1版本为最新的技术规范版本。此版本是在2005年12月31日由XBRL国际组织发布的,这个版本最新一次修订是在2008年7月2日实施的。其内容包括规格说明书、XML schema文件和符合性套件,技术规范也一直在不断完善自己。这次修订对分类标准以及实例文档的语法和语义进行的详细说明解释。简单点来说,我们可以把技术规范作为教你如何构建分类标准以及实例文档指导教科书来看。
XBRL技术规范明确规定了XBRL概念理论,主要目的是为了用来规范的制定XBRL分类标准,它也是XBRL的基础。在实际运用的过程里各个国家可以参考XBRL的技术规范来按照自己国家的情况来制定本国家的XBRL分类标准。在分类标准的制定中所提出的新版本的要通过公开底稿的形式来展示,以便日后更加方便地对公开底稿加以研究,并完善其不足之处,从而使新的技术规范得到组织的正式承认。而且还要积极地将新的规定进行推广运用以便使其在实际运用中能更好地完善。
(二)XBRL的分类标准
为了方便理解,在此之前我们要先介绍一下以XRBL应用对象为基础的技术分类标准-XRBL财务报告(英文全称为Financial Reporting,FR)和XBRL的分类账(英文全称为General Ledger,GL)。首先要介绍的XBRL FR是对XBRL财务报告分类标准体系的描述,从而确定将不同的财务报告的分类标准使其保持一致的标准制度。债权人、投资者、监管部门和其他信息使用者可以通过XBRL FR得到自己所需要的披露信息。因为各个国家会计准则有所不同,所以为了符合各国国情,其会计准则的分类标准也有所不同。XBRL在运用中所建立的不同标签的统称为分类标准,分类标准一定要与技术规范相符合。从应用角度来划分分类标准,可以将其划分成两个层次:第一个层次是从财务报告方面来划分的,可以称之为财务报告分类标准,第二个层次是从总分类账以及经济交易或事项层面来划分的,可以称之为财务记账分类标准。现在新出现的内嵌XBRL式技术可以同时囊括财务报告分类标准和财务报告分类标准,可以说是现在作为先一项XBRL方面的先进技术成果。发展到现在,我国再制定财务报告分类标准方面还是取得了一些可喜的成果,最大成果就是有三个标准获得了XBRL国际的认可。虽然取得了一些成果,但是还有很多不足落后之处。例如我国的财务记账分类标准才刚刚起步,仅仅处于理论研究阶段,更不用说制定出可以采用的财务记账分类标准。也因为XBRL分类标准研究处于一定的瓶颈阶段,对于我国XBRL技术的未来发展还是具有一定的影响的。因为如果说XBRL分类标准作为XBRL技术的重中之重,一点也不为过。同时它也是生成实例文档必要前提。分类标准的制定要在合乎规范准则的基础上根据各国制定的相关的法律法规制度和国情的实际情况来制定。大多数情况下,一个分类标准是由一个具备核心模式的文件和五个链接库文件所组成。在这当中,模式文件起到了将分类标准中所有元素以及元素属性的文件进行定义的作用。例如我国通用分类标准中所有的元素都在同一个模式文件中定义,模式文件后缀名为“.xsd”。而链接库则是作为描述模式文件中元素之间所存在关系的相关文件,它具体包括了列表报表的链接库、定义的链接库、计算所采用的链接库、标签所需要的链接库、具有参考意义的链接库。这些链接库文件后缀名都为“.xml”。
①报链接库文件:定义了分类标准各元素之间在列报结构上存在的联系(包括层次之间存在的联系和顺序之间的联系),即在子项目的所有展示顺序要在父项目下来进行排列。
②定义链接库文件:概念之间的定义层次关系是由其来描述的,例如现象与本质、一般与特殊的关系等。
③计算链接库文件:模式文件里各个元素之间数值之间的计算关系是由其来组织的。但计算链接库文件有很大的限制,那就是它只能对同一上下文下的元素之间的加减关系进行处理,例如,它仅把年度现金和银行存款的做加减处理,但不能把年度现金和年度银行存款之间的做加减处理。所以,现在存在的公式链接库可以将计算功能上的缺陷进行一定的弥补,可以使其跨越上下文之间的鸿沟来进行计算,更为先进的是现在即使是复杂数据关系也能很好的解决,同时也提供了数据验证这一强大的功能。(www.daowen.com)
④参考链接库文件:它是描述模式文件中用来描述其含有的元素定位参考文件中的权威定义,所引用的参考文件大多数是已经公开发布的法律及法规文件。
⑤标签链接库文件:它的作用是给模式文件中元素对应的一个或者多个方便阅读者阅读和理解位置做一个标记,显示其标记名称方便阅读者日后查阅。
(三)XBRL实例文档
XBRL实例文档其实是一套数据元素的财务事项集合并以XML文档的形式最终呈现在使用者眼前的,它是通过实际使用的分类标准中的概念来进行标记的。XML文件它可以说是元数据性质的标记文件,详细地说,如果在上下文不存在联系的情况之下,这些数据可以说数据是没有什么作用的,但是如果这些源数据获得了XBRL分类标准所能够拥有的定义标记,我们就能够了解它的真实含义。
对实例文档性质中存在的数据及标签进行整理,能够提高被计算机读取效率。我们国家的企业财务报告就是运用分类的标准而产生的实例性文档。对于会计实务中的一般财务信息使用者来说,实例文档对他们几乎没有什么帮助。这是由于实例文档是将XBRL作为根元素的片段,在一般人眼中看来和一堆乱码没有区别,根本不能理解其意义,因此就必须通过一定的转换工具将实例文档转换成可以被大多数使用者所理解的文档。实例文档其本质就是数据元素的集合,这些元素通过其使用的分类标准进行命名。
(四)样式表
XBRL实例文档是一些数据和可以进行解释的标签的集合。用户在通过浏览器将某个XBRL数据的文件打开的时候,能够迅速知道他看到数据的真正含义。而加入用户必须对可以提供进行打印的财务报表进行整理编排,实例文档很难满足其需求。为了解决这些问题,可扩展样式单、级联样式单或电子表格等样式单就起到了很大的作用,它们能够在XBRL的实例化的文档中增加少许必需的表现元素,从而形成HTML或者是其余格式的可输出文件。
XBRL实例性文档所具有的源数据可以通过会计应用软件和计算机电子表格和人工进行输入等多种方法取得。XML“标记”可以用来对XBRL中的数据进行标记,换句话说,在XBRL实例的文档中使用与数据有关的元素都能独立标记出来,使其不损失其原有的含义。实例文档能用多种方式进行交换、发布,也可以转换成HTML、PDF等格式的文档。
免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。